East Asian Folktales, Myths & Legends Synopsis

 

A beautiful new edition of retellings of classic folktales, myths and legends from China, Korea, Japan and beyond.

Follow the journey of the twelve animals of the Chinese Zodiac, explore the history of major festivals and meet legendary figures - such as the famous Hua Mulan - in this beautiful collection of folktales richly retold for young readers by Eva Wong Nava.

  • Includes 18 East Asian folktales, myths and legends in a perfect, child-friendly package.
  • Part of the Scholastic Classics collection: introducing generations of book lovers to timeless stories, repackaged especially for younger readers.
  • Features traditional favourites, including the widely popular story of Mulan and the fairy tale of Chang'e, Hou Yi and the rabbit in the moon, featured in the animated film On the Moon.
